欢迎访问宙启技术站
智能推送

PHP中的count函数如何获取数组的元素数量?

发布时间:2023-06-13 00:21:11

PHP中的count()函数是用来获取数组的元素数量的,它是一个内置函数。count()函数采用一个数组作为参数,并返回该数组中的元素数量。有时候,我们需要在写PHP程序时获取在程序中使用的数组的元素数量,这个时候,就可以使用count()函数获取数组的元素数量。

用法

count()函数可以用于几乎所有类型的变量,包括数组、对象和字符串。它的语法如下所示:

count($array, $mode)

其中,$array是一个数组,$mode是一个可选参数。当$mode为0(默认值)时,count()函数返回数组中元素的数量。当$mode为1时,count()函数返回递归计算的数组的元素的数量(数组中的元素包括另一个数组)。如果$mode被设置为2,则count()函数返回递归计算的数组的元素的数量和每个数组中值的类型。

代码示例

以下是一个示例程序,演示了如何使用count()函数来获取数组的元素数量:

<?php

$fruits = array("apple", "banana", "orange", "peach");

echo "The number of elements in the array is: " . count($fruits);

?>

输出:

The number of elements in the array is: 4

在上面的示例中,我们声明了一个数组$fruits,其中包括四种水果。我们使用count()函数来获取这个数组中的元素数量,并在屏幕上输出。

总结

在本文中,我们学习了如何使用PHP中的count()函数来获取一个数组中的元素数量。通过将一个数组作为参数传递给count()函数,我们可以获取数组中的所有元素的计数。在真实的项目中,我们会经常使用count()函数来获取数组的元素数量。